McNelis Niamh

November 19, 1999
Meath's Niamh McNelis NAME: Niamh McNelis DATE OF BIRTH: 24-3-73 HEIGHT: 5' 9" CLUB: Summerhill COUNTY: Meath NOTABLE SPORTING ACHIEVEMENTS (GAELIC): Club: 2 Division 2 Leagues; 1 Junior Championship; 1 Senior Championship county. County: 2 Junior Leinster Championships, 3 Senior Leinster Championships; Junior All-Ireland 1994; Division 2 National League 1993, 1994 and 1998 TOUGHEST OPPONENT: These days they're all tough - maybe it's old age! FAVOURITE GROUNDS: Dr Cullen Park, Carlow HOBBIES: Photography, cooking, cycling, socialising FAVOURITE POSITION: Midfield WORST PLAYER TO TRAIN THAT YOU KNOW: Can't say - she's on my team MOST EMBARRASSING MOMENT ON OR OFF THE FOOTBALL FIELD: Leinster Final 1999. I was just about to gain possession of the ball when someone in the crowd blew a whistle. I stopped, turned to the ref, who had his hands in the air in confusion, while my opponent went on a long solo run with no-one in pursuit FAVOURITE PLAYERS: Colm O'Rourke, Eileen Dardis INFLUENCES ON YOUR CAREER: Mother, Austin Lyons THE HIGH POINT OF YOUR CAREER TO DATE: Winning senior club championship in 1998 BIGGEST DISAPPOINTMENT: Losing 1998 All-Ireland semi final to Monaghan OTHER PLAYERS WITH A PROMISING FUTURE: Elaine Lynch, Ciara Kennedy DISLIKES ABOUT THE GAA: Lack of support towards ladies football - but improving! RELATIVES INVOLVED IN GAELIC GAMES: Father played with Donegal and Lough, uncle played with Mayo and Meath PERSON YOU WOULD MOST LIKE TO MEET: Elvis PET HATES: People biting their nails FAVOURITE FILM: The Lion King WHAT WOULD YOU DO IF YOU WON THE LOTTO: Retire IDEAL DATE: Already have one! HOW WOULD YOU LIKE TO BE REMEMBERED: As a committed, enthusiastic and fair player Taken from Hogan Stand magazine 19th November 1999 Vol 9 No 47
